The 'week' 4 results are in.....


Flaming Fairies 17 - Bozos 17

It was a game of blown opportunities for both teams as the Fairies and Bozos played to a 17 all draw. Three sacks and an interception by the Bozo defense countered a poor performance by their quarterback, Pi while 7 penalties for 55 yards negated a fine performance by Fairies quarterback, Tommy Cruise.

The game got off to a great start for San Francisco as Cruise completed 3 of 5 passes during a long 80 yard, 14 play drive that resulted in a 21 yard TD catch by their tight end, Gene Simmons. The Bozos struck back quickly on a 1 yard dive by More or Less to make the score 7-7 at the end of one. The Fairies drove to the Bozos 13, but had to settle for a field goal by Pat Medown following a sack on Cruise by One Eleven. A nice catch by 5 ½ got the clowns deep into Fairy territory where Bernie’s 32 yard field goal tied the game at 10 at the half.

The clowns took a 17-10 lead midway through the third quarter on a 32 yard TD run by 5 ½. After an exchange of punts, the Fairies drove 63 yards in 10 plays and tied the game on Simmons’ second TD catch. Both sides had a chance to win the game in the final minutes, but neither team was able to mount any sort of offense, and the game ended in a 17 all draw.

2 Cents led the Bozo offense, rushing for 113 yards on 7 carries, while Pi had the worst game of his career, finishing 1-6-1 for only 17 yards and was sacked once. The Fairies’ Cruise was 8-13-1 and 2 TD’s. On defense, Rod Stroker had 3 tackles and a sack for San Francisco while One Eleven was a beast for Battle Creek with 6 tackles and 2 sacks.
